Job Description - Director of Business Development

Major Areas of Focus

The DBD is a role that focuses on two key aspects of business growth, first a safety net for client retention. The DBD oversees client satisfaction surveys and manages large portfolio clients or strategic accounts. The second area of focus is new business development. The DBD directly oversees Business Developers whose only function is to cultivate and identify new business opportunities. The DBD also supports the business units of each assigned Director of Operations  (DOO) by working closely with Account Executives. The DBD aids Account Executives with outside sales activity, ensuring that they are working as efficiently as possible and making the best use of company assets including our proprietary CRM software. The DBD attends and supports the weekly sales meetings of each business unit in his division. The DBD is an ally to the DOO, not a foe. 

As a Director the DBD is a steward of ECF Culture remembering that every deal sold by the company impacts our front-line workforce. Therefore negotiating fair and equitable contracts is paramount in preserving our culture and the protections offered to our front-line. This fact means that the DBD helps to balance sales goals with compassion for others, and by doing so contributes to a sustainable business platform. 

These roles directly report to the DBD: Inside Sales Coordinator; and these indirectly report to the DBD: Account Executives

Essential duties and responsibilities include the following. Other duties may also be assigned.

Strategic Accounts

  • Directly manages customer accounts that have been designated as Strategic generally on the "Relationship" level
  • Develops a cohesive customer satisfaction plan that ensures our Operations team and Sales team are professionally managing customer service and service delivery to Strategic Accounts

Diversity Program Management

  • Manages all of the company's registrations with various corporations on their respective diversity portals, maintaining and updating our registration and records on said portals
  • Participates in networking events with various minority supplier chapters that are located within our market coverage area
  • Represents the company at various events and works closely with the family for appearances and networking 

Third-Party Vendor System Oversight

  • Works with the Director of Home office to ensure our registrations for various third-party vendor management systems such as Avetta, IS Net, Coupa, Jaggaer, etc. are up to date and accurate. 
  • Determines whether marketing or sales activities are warranted using third-party vendor management systems, manages related sales activities

Training

  • Trains various personnel on proper CRM utilization and record keeping best practices for sales-related records
  • Helps Account Executives to build a playbook, and schedule for optimal sales activity
  • Prepares for and implements specialized training as needed for the entire Sales and Operations teams for assigned Service Centers 

Outside Sales Support

  • Attends weekly sales checkpoint meetings with each Account Executive for assigned Service Centers
  • Support the Account Executives and Directors of Operations for assigned Service Centers with training, deal guidance, negotiations, presentations, price development
  • Is present for interviews for new Account Executives, the Director of Operations will rely on the opinions of the DBD, and if there is any disagreement that the candidate should be hired, then the matter will be escalated to the President before hiring

Image Control

  • Is neat and presentable, and balances the type of clothing that will be appropriate for each venue or event
  • Promotes etiquette, proper dress, and manners for all interactions with clients for all internal team members
